Budget Smart phone - Panasonic Eluga I5 Launched in India

Today Launching
A day after the Redmi Y1 and Redmi Y1 Lite hit the market, Panasonic has launched a budget smartphone -- named Eluga I5 -- in India. 

The Panasonic Eluga I5 price is Rs. 6,490 (MRP Rs. 8,990), and the handset will be available exclusively on Flipkart, in Black and Gold colour options. 

The e-commerce startup is offering exchange discount of up to Rs. 6,000 and additional 5 percent off on Axis Bank Buzz credit card payments with the Eluga I5.

Panasonic Eluga I5 specifications:

The Panasonic Eluga I5 has a 5-inch HD display with 720x1280 pixels resolution and 2.5D curved Asahi Dragontrail glass protection.

It is powered by an octa-core MediaTek MT6737 chipset coupled with 2GB of RAM.
The dual-SIM (Micro + Nano)handset has hybrid setup, and runs on Android Nougat 7.0 operating system.

It has a 13-megapixel rear camera with five-piece lens and f/2.2 aperture and an LED flash. On the front, the smartphone has a 5-megapixel camera with a three-piece lens.

It comes with 16GB of inbuilt storage that is expandable via microSD card (up to 128GB).

Highlights on the Panasonic Eluga I5 :

  • 4G VoLTE,
  •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n,
  • Bluetooth v4,
  • FM radio,
  • A-GPS,
  • Micro-USB with OTG, and
  • 3.5mm audio jack.
  • Sensors on board include an accelerometer, ambient light sensor, proximity sensor, and a proximity sensor.
  • The handset also has a fingerprint sensor on the back of its metal body.
  • Besides, it is powered by a 2500mAh battery that's a non-removable one, and measures 143x71x7.5mm along with a weight of 145.5 grams.
